Why We Love Screen-Free Gifts for Toddlers
Toddlers learn best through movement, repetition, and play they can control themselves. Screen-free toys give them the freedom to explore at their own pace, problem-solve, and use their imagination. They also support important developmental milestones like hand-eye coordination, early language skills, and social-emotional growth.
As a toddler playspace, we intentionally choose toys that invite open-ended play — meaning there’s no “right” or “wrong” way to use them. These are the types of toys kids return to again and again, whether they’re building towers, serving pretend snacks, or flipping pages of a favorite book.

Wooden Blocks & Building Toys
Classic wooden blocks are a staple in our playspace for a reason. They encourage creativity, spatial awareness, and problem-solving — and they grow with your child. One day they’re stacking, the next they’re building “cities” or pretending blocks are food or cars.
Cause-and-Effect & Discovery Toys
Toys that pop, slide, spin, or make gentle sounds help toddlers understand how their actions create results. These toys are incredibly engaging and support fine motor development while keeping play fun and interactive.
Pretend Food & Imaginative Play
Pretend kitchens and food play are always a hit with our little visitors. These toys support early social skills, vocabulary development, and imaginative thinking. They’re also perfect for sibling play and role-playing everyday routines.
Books That Invite Interaction
Board books with simple stories, bright illustrations, and tactile elements are ideal Valentine’s gifts. Reading together builds language skills and creates cozy moments — and many toddlers love books they can “play” with just as much as toys.
